What is a Hotel API and Why is it Needed for OTAs?

 In today’s fast-paced travel industry, providing a seamless and efficient hotel booking experience is essential for the success of Online Travel Agencies (OTAs). One of the most critical tools for OTAs to achieve this is the Hotel API. But what exactly is a Hotel API, and why is it so essential for OTAs?

In this blog, we’ll break down what a Hotel API is, how it works, and why it’s a crucial component for OTAs looking to stay competitive and offer exceptional service to customers.


What is a Hotel API?

An Application Programming Interface (API) is essentially a set of rules and protocols that allow different software applications to communicate with each other. A Hotel API is a specialized type of API that allows OTAs, travel platforms, and other booking websites to access real-time data about hotel availability, pricing, and booking options from various suppliers.

With a Hotel API, OTAs can retrieve essential information, such as:

  • Hotel Availability: Real-time information on available rooms, their types, and configurations.
  • Hotel Pricing: Information on room rates, discounts, and special offers.
  • Booking Capabilities: The ability to make bookings, including managing reservations, cancellations, and modifications.

The Hotel API acts as the bridge between OTAs and multiple suppliers, allowing OTAs to connect to vast hotel inventories from various sources, such as global distribution systems (GDS), bedbanks, hotel chains, and independent properties.


How Does a Hotel API Work?

A Hotel API operates by connecting an OTA platform with external hotel databases. Here's how it typically works:

  1. Search Request: A user visits the OTA's website or app and searches for hotel options in a specific location for a set of dates.
  2. API Query: The OTA sends a request (or query) to the Hotel API, which asks the API for available hotels that match the user’s search criteria (e.g., location, dates, room type).
  3. Data Retrieval: The Hotel API queries multiple hotel suppliers or databases to retrieve real-time availability, pricing, and other relevant information.
  4. Response: The Hotel API sends the requested data back to the OTA, which displays the search results to the user on the website or app.
  5. Booking: Once the user selects a hotel, the OTA sends a booking request to the Hotel API, which facilitates the reservation with the supplier, processes payment, and sends a confirmation to the user.

This integration allows OTAs to offer real-time data about hotels without having to manually manage the vast amount of inventory and data themselves.


Why Do OTAs Need a Hotel API?

OTAs have become the go-to platforms for travelers booking accommodations, offering convenience, price comparison, and a wide range of options. To remain competitive in this market, OTAs need to provide a fast, reliable, and seamless booking experience. This is where a Hotel API becomes indispensable.

Here are several key reasons why OTAs need to integrate a Hotel API into their platforms:

1. Access to Real-Time Data

One of the most significant benefits of a Hotel API is that it provides access to real-time data on hotel availability and pricing. Traditional methods of managing hotel inventories—such as manually contacting suppliers or relying on outdated spreadsheets—can lead to errors in availability or incorrect pricing.

With a Hotel API, OTAs get live data directly from hotel suppliers, ensuring that customers always see accurate information on available rooms and prices. This reduces the likelihood of overbookings, increases customer satisfaction, and ensures that OTAs offer competitive pricing.

2. Vast Inventory Access

OTAs want to offer a wide range of hotel options to their customers, but manually negotiating contracts with thousands of hotels or suppliers is impractical. A Hotel API eliminates the need for this, giving OTAs instant access to millions of hotel listings from a global network of suppliers.

By integrating a Hotel API, OTAs can expand their inventory to include both well-known hotel chains and smaller independent properties, offering their users more choices and catering to a broader range of preferences and budgets.

3. Increased Efficiency

Without a Hotel API, OTAs would need to manually manage supplier relationships, input hotel data, and update room availability. This is time-consuming and error-prone.

By integrating a Hotel API, OTAs can automate much of this process, reducing the need for human intervention, saving time, and minimizing the risk of errors. With an API, the flow of information is streamlined, allowing OTAs to update listings, pricing, and availability in real-time without manual updates.

4. Scalability and Flexibility

As OTAs grow and expand to new regions or markets, they need an efficient way to scale their platform and integrate with additional hotel suppliers. A Hotel API offers scalability by providing access to more suppliers and properties as your business grows, without requiring major changes to your infrastructure.

Whether you’re adding a new destination or offering additional hotel chains, integrating a Hotel API ensures that you can easily scale your platform and accommodate growing demand without extensive manual work or redevelopment.

5. Enhanced Customer Experience

In today’s highly competitive market, providing a positive user experience is crucial to success. OTAs must offer a quick, intuitive, and easy-to-navigate booking process to attract and retain customers. A Hotel API helps improve the customer experience by:

  • Providing accurate real-time availability to prevent customers from booking unavailable rooms.
  • Offering fast booking processes by enabling seamless reservations through a direct connection with the hotel’s system.
  • Displaying competitive rates by pulling in the latest pricing from multiple suppliers in real-time.

With a Hotel API, OTAs can ensure that customers have an efficient and smooth booking journey, leading to higher conversion rates and repeat business.

6. Cost-Effectiveness

Building and maintaining custom integrations with each individual hotel supplier can be an expensive and resource-intensive process. By integrating a Hotel API, OTAs can avoid the high costs associated with developing and managing these connections in-house.

Most Hotel APIs offer flexible pricing models based on usage, meaning OTAs only pay for what they use. This cost-effective solution allows OTAs to focus their resources on growing their business, improving marketing strategies, and delivering better services to their customers.


Conclusion

A Hotel API is essential for OTAs looking to enhance their platform, improve operational efficiency, and offer a seamless customer experience. By providing access to real-time hotel data, vast supplier networks, and automated workflows, a Hotel API enables OTAs to scale their operations, reduce costs, and improve their booking systems.

In a world where travelers demand instant access to accurate information and hassle-free booking experiences, integrating a Hotel API is no longer just an option—it’s a necessity for staying competitive and meeting the ever-changing needs of the market.

If you're an OTA looking to take your hotel booking system to the next level, integrating a Hotel API should be at the top of your priority list. It’s the key to unlocking efficiency, growth, and enhanced customer satisfaction.

Comments

Popular posts from this blog

Top 8 Hotel Booking API Provider 2024 - Next Gen Hotel Booking Engines

Top 10 Hotel API Providers in 2025 | Find Your Best Fit

How B2B Travel Software Transforming in the Travel Industry